Instead, they focus on pro-Palestine activists in the UK who are currently engaged in hunger strikes to protest their imprisonment and treatment. These activists, linked to the Palestine Action group, are being held on remand and face potentially lengthy pre-trial detention. The hunger strikes have garnered attention and support, particularly in Belfast, where they evoke memories of the 1981 Irish republican hunger strikes. Demonstrations have taken place, including the daubing of the Ministry of Justice building with red paint, to demand better treatment for the hunger strikers and a meeting with the Justice Secretary. The activists' actions highlight concerns about the length of pre-trial detention and the treatment of pro-Palestine activists within the UK justice system. The deteriorating health of the hunger strikers, as exemplified by Heba Muraisi's statement about contemplating death, underscores the urgency of the situation.
